Population breakdown by gender

Population in zip code 07095 is 20,596 residents | Male to Female ratio is 1:1.00 | Zip Code 07095 land area is 4.1241 sq. miles | Population density is 4,994.06 residents per square mile

Median age

  Median Age
Zip Code Median Age 35.1
Median Age - Male 34
Median Age - Female 36.8

Median age of zip code 07095 is 6.1% lower compared to nearby zip codes and 5.6% lower compared to the United States median age. Comparing gender-specific madian age yields the following results. Male median age of zip code 07095 is 6.3% lower compared to nearby zip codes and 5% lower compared to the United States male median age. Female zip code 07095 median age is 4.4% lower in comparison to nearby zip codes and 4.4% lower compared to female national median age average.

Real Estate

Metric Value
Housing occupied 94.58%
Housing vacant 5.42%
Housing occupied by owner 60.81%
Housing occupied by tenant 39.19%
Total Rented Units 2900
Median Contract Gross Rent $1,320
Median Gross Rent $1,483
Median Home Value $291,900

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 07095 median gross rent is 12.35% larger then the median contract rent.
